What exactly is web design, and how is it different from web development? Print

Web design focuses on the visual aspects and user experience of a website—how it looks, feels, and guides the user. This includes layout, color schemes, typography, and responsive design.

Web development, on the other hand, involves the coding and technical implementation of the site. Designers create the vision; developers build the functionality.

In short:

  • Design = Appearance & User Experience (UI/UX)
  • Development = Code & Functionality (HTML, CSS, JavaScript, CMS, etc.)
